- Title
MESON BARYON COMPONENTS IN THE STATES OF THE BARYON DECUPLET.
- Authors
ACETI, F.; OSET, E.; DAI, L. R.; ZHANG, Y.; GENG, L. S.
- Abstract
We extend the Weinberg compositeness condition to partial waves of L = 1 and resonant states to determine the weight of meson-baryon component in the baryon decuplet. We obtain an appreciable weight of πN in the Δ(1232) wave function, of the order of 60 % and we also show that, as we go to higher energies in the members of the decuplet, the weights of meson-baryon component decrease and they already show a dominant part for a genuine component in the wave function. We interpret the meaning of the Weinberg sum-rule extended to complex energies.
